Queen Elizabeth Rebuked Meghan Markle Over Wedding Caterer Incident, New Book Claims

A royal biographer alleges the late Queen intervened after Meghan Markle's behavior toward staff during a 2018 menu tasting sparked complaints.

Overview

  • Katie Nicholl’s book, 'The New Royals,' details an alleged 2018 incident where Meghan Markle berated a caterer over a vegan dish at Windsor Castle.
  • The late Queen Elizabeth reportedly intervened, telling Meghan, 'In this family we don’t speak to people like that.'
  • The incident has reignited scrutiny of Meghan's treatment of royal staff, including previous allegations of bullying raised by former communications secretary Jason Knauf.
  • Meghan Markle has consistently denied all claims of bullying, calling them a 'calculated smear campaign' and emphasizing her commitment to compassion and support for others.
  • The controversy reflects ongoing tensions around Meghan’s leadership style, with some former staff defending her as respectful and supportive while others describe challenging working conditions.
